What is a Software Engineer at The Church of Jesus Christ of Latter-day Saints?
The role of a Software Engineer at The Church of Jesus Christ of Latter-day Saints is pivotal in shaping the digital landscape of the Church’s services and outreach. As a Software Engineer, you will be tasked with creating and maintaining applications that facilitate the mission of the Church, enhancing the experience of users through technology. This role significantly impacts both the internal workings of the Church and the external services provided to its members worldwide.
Your contributions will be directed toward various projects, including managing databases, developing web applications, and ensuring that the Church's online services are reliable and user-friendly. You will work alongside teams that are dedicated to advancing the Church's digital presence, including contributions to platforms like FamilySearch and other communal resources. The complexity and scale of the projects you will engage with make this role both challenging and rewarding, emphasizing the importance of your technical expertise and collaborative spirit.
Expect to be involved in innovative problem-solving, utilizing cutting-edge technologies to build scalable solutions that align with the Church’s vision and values. This role not only demands technical proficiency but also a commitment to service and the mission of the Church.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for The Church of Jesus Christ of Latter-day Saints from real interviews. Click any question to practice and review the answer.
Explain the differences between synchronous and asynchronous programming paradigms.
Explain how to improve coding solutions by reducing time complexity first, then balancing space trade-offs.
Problem At Stripe, a service stores event sequences as singly linked lists. Write a function that reverses a singly linked list and returns the new head. ...
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
Preparation is key to a successful interview at The Church of Jesus Christ of Latter-day Saints. Focus on showcasing your technical capabilities while demonstrating your alignment with the Church’s values.
Role-related knowledge – You need to exhibit a strong foundation in software development principles, familiarizing yourself with industry best practices. Interviewers will assess your ability to apply these principles to create effective solutions.
Problem-solving ability – Your approach to challenges is crucial. Be prepared to articulate your thought process clearly and demonstrate how you tackle complex problems. You can illustrate your problem-solving skills by discussing past experiences where you successfully navigated technical hurdles.
Culture fit / values – Understanding and embodying the values of The Church of Jesus Christ of Latter-day Saints is essential. Interviewers will look for evidence of your teamwork, integrity, and commitment to service. Reflect on how your personal values align with those of the Church.
Interview Process Overview
The interview process for the Software Engineer position at The Church of Jesus Christ of Latter-day Saints is designed to rigorously evaluate both technical skills and cultural fit. Candidates typically experience a multi-stage process that begins with an initial screening, followed by technical assessments and behavioral interviews.
Throughout this process, the emphasis is on collaboration and user-centered design. Interviewers focus on understanding how well you can communicate technical concepts and work within a team environment. Expect a mix of interviews, including coding challenges, system design discussions, and conversations about your previous experiences.
Sign up to read the full guide
Create a free account to unlock the complete interview guide with all sections.
Sign up freeAlready have an account? Sign in




